

Bernstein's essential Symphonies, Concert & Theater Works, Ballets and Songs, specially curated and presented in 4 segments: Bernstein conducts Bernstein, Theater Works, Songs, Concert & Chamber Music. The "Bernstein conducts Bernstein" Columbia stereo-recordings from 1960 to 1974, remastered from the original analogue tapes using 24 bit / 192 kHz technology.
Special CD with The Canadian Brass and a newly compiled Double-CD Bernstein in Jazz, featuring Dave Brubeck, Gary Burton, Aaron Bell, Eldar Djanirov, J. Johnson, Brandford & Ellis Marsalis, Gerry Mulligan, André Previn, Martial Solal, Richard Stoltzman et al. Our grading is based on the system used by Record Collector magazine as described below (We don't sell CDs with a grading of less than very good). Mint: The CD itself is in brand new condition with no surface marks or deterioration in sound quality. The cover and any extra items such as the lyric sheet, booklet or poster are in perfect condition. CDs advertised as Sealed or Unplayed should be Mint.
Excellent: The CD shows some signs of having been played, but there is very little lessening in sound quality. The cover and packaging might have slight wear and/or creasing. Very Good: The CD has obviously been played many times, but displays no major deterioration in sound quality, despite noticeable surface marks and the occasional light scratch. Normal wear and tear on the cover or extra items, without any major defects, is acceptable.
